Service Projects
Each State President serves a one-year term, and selects a
Theme and a Project to accomplish during their year in office.  The Project is located in or around Washington, D.C. 
All Local Societies and the State Officers work together on fundraising to support the State Project!


2010-2011
Healthy Kids, Healthy Future
Sarah Jones, State President
To raise funds for D.C. Central Kitchen's "Healthy Returns" Program,
which provides healthy after-school snacks for low-income children and at-risk youth.

The State Project earned $1100 for "Healthy Returns" this year!
